What to Look for in a Wauconda Estate Planning Attorney

  • Experience with Illinois law. Estate planning rules vary by state — wills, trusts, and powers of attorney must comply with Illinois-specific statutes. Look for attorneys whose practice focuses on Illinois estate law.
  • Clear, flat-fee pricing. Many estate planning attorneys charge flat fees for standard documents (wills, trusts, POAs). Ask upfront what's included so you can compare costs without surprises.
  • Strong client reviews. Look for consistent 4–5 star reviews that mention responsiveness, clear explanations, and thoroughness — not just friendliness. Estate planning requires attention to detail.
  • Full-service estate planning. The best attorneys handle the full picture — wills, revocable living trusts, healthcare directives, durable powers of attorney, and beneficiary coordination.
